Hage earned his bachelor's degree in Civil Engineering from the University of Illinois at Urbana-Champaign. He went on to receive his JD from Chicago-Kent College of Law in 1997. He has worked as a prosecutor for the DuPage County State Attorney's Office. He has also served as legal counsel to the State Senate Judiciary Committee.
Elections
2012
Hage ran in the 2012 election for Illinois House of Representatives District 42. Hage was defeated by Jeanne M. Ives in the Republican primary on March 20, 2012.[1][2]
